掌握项目管理技能是迈向成为软件项目经理之路的关键。项目管理不仅涉及项目规划、执行和监控,还包括资源管理、风险评估、沟通协调以及利益相关者管理等多个方面。以下是如何系统地掌握这些技能,并逐步迈向软件项目经理角色的一些建议:
1. 理解PMBOK(项目管理知识体系指南)
- 深入研读PMBOK:了解项目管理的五大过程组(启动、规划、执行、监控与控制、收尾)和十个知识领域(如范围、时间、成本、质量、人力资源、沟通、采购、风险、干系人管理等)。
- 实践应用:通过实际项目来应用PMBOK中的理论,不断修正和完善自己的项目管理方法。
2. 增强技术能力与工具熟练度
- 学习编程语言:至少掌握一门编程语言(如Python或Java),这有助于你更好地理解和实现自动化任务,提高开发效率。
- 熟悉软件开发生命周期:了解从需求收集到产品发布的整个开发周期,这将帮助你更好地规划和管理项目。
- 掌握项目管理工具:熟练使用Jira、Trello、Asana等项目管理工具,这些工具可以帮助你跟踪项目进度,管理任务和文档。
3. 培养良好的沟通能力
- 有效沟通:无论是与团队成员还是利益相关者,都需要能够清晰、准确地传达信息。
- 倾听技巧:学会倾听他人的意见和反馈,这对于项目的顺利进行至关重要。
4. 提升风险管理能力
- 识别潜在风险:了解常见的项目风险,并学会如何识别和管理这些风险。
- 制定应对策略:为可能的风险制定预防和应对措施,确保项目能够在遇到问题时迅速响应。
5. 加强团队协作与领导力
- 团队合作:作为软件项目经理,需要具备强大的团队协作能力,能够激励团队成员发挥最大潜力。
- 领导能力:学会如何领导和激励团队,确保项目目标的达成。
6. 持续学习和适应变化
- 跟进行业动态:关注最新的项目管理理论、技术和工具,保持知识的更新。
- 灵活应变:在项目过程中遇到挑战时,能够快速调整策略和方法,适应变化。
7. 建立专业网络
- 参加行业活动:积极参与行业会议、研讨会等活动,与同行交流经验,扩大人脉。
- 加入专业组织:加入项目管理专业机构,如PMI等,获取更多资源和支持。
8. 获得相关认证
- 考取PMP认证:PMP(项目管理专业人士)认证是项目管理领域的金标准,通过此认证可以证明自己的专业能力和对项目管理知识体系的掌握。
- 参加其他认证培训:根据个人兴趣和职业发展需求,参加其他项目管理相关认证的培训课程,以提升自己的竞争力。
总之,通过上述步骤的学习和实践,你可以逐步建立起一套完善的项目管理技能体系,为成为一名优秀的软件项目经理打下坚实的基础。